How much does a wedding photographer cost in the South of France?
Packages start around €1,890 for 10 hours of coverage. The final price depends on the length of coverage, the venue and any add-ons.
How far in advance should we book?
Ideally 6 to 12 months ahead, especially for a wedding between May and September.
